![]() Reduced unnecessary Moneydance+ console messages.On Windows and Linux, Moneydance now allocates a maximum amount of RAM based on the amount available on the computer.Made the Security Price History report treat date ranges consistently with other reports and graphs.Fixed the contrast of Foresight graph annotations in dark mode.Added -nobackup flag to skip performing automatic backups when running from the command-line.Fixed a bug where “last N days” date range presets incorrectly included the current date.Fixed a bug where some Moneydance+ functions could produce an error if there was a delay when loading a file.Fixed a bug that prevented maintaining ‘infinite’ backups.Recorded more complete investment transaction data downloaded via Moneydance+.Reduced logging when listing files/folders in Dropbox Connection and iCloud Drive sync methods.Improved performance and reduced memory usage when switching between files.Fixed trial period transaction counting.Pressing enter/return in a date field now moves the focus to the next field.If there are too many items in the Moneydance+ Accounts popup, they now overflow to a sub-menu to avoid running off the screen.OFX and Moneydance+ downloads now use a smarter algorithm to determine the ‘last download’ date, preventing issues when an account is reconnected or configured to download from multiple sources.When syncing to/from mobile devices, Moneydance now re-creates folders that may have been erroneously deleted, rather than failing.When syncing, files uploaded from the same device are no longer downloaded, saving a small amount of bandwidth.Fixed a bug where the previous version of Moneydance showed a loan’s starting principal in the balance adjustment field.Moneydance now preserves Moneydance+ status across restarts, eliminating the need to refresh from the net immediately after opening a file.Made a search field tweak to prevent text selection issues in certain circumstances.Fixed a bug that prevented saving changes to check printing settings.Fixed a bug that caused downloaded transactions not to be added to the register when a currency rate or security price was a non-positive number.When opening an account in a new window, the window is now offset slightly, and its location is reset to the top or left if it would otherwise move off-screen.Allow selection and deletion of multiple reminders simultaneously.Moneydance now auto-commits scheduled reminders (if enabled) 5 seconds after loading a file, then every 3 hours thereafter.Implemented atomic balance recalculation, which fixes occasional summary screen issues following updates from background syncing.A new Undo/Redo system which includes batch changes, file imports, as well as confirming and merging downloaded transactions.Improved initial syncing performance by performing many small download operations in parallel.Improved syncing performance for files with a large number of attachments.You can now use emojis anywhere you can enter text, including account and category names and transactions!.The macOS version of Moneydance is now a universal binary and runs natively on Apple Silicon Macs.Here are the release notes for Moneydance 2023.2: This update includes a large number of small enhancements and various bug fixes to provide a smoother experience.Īvailable for immediate download for Mac, Windows, and Linux from our site. We are thrilled to announce the release of Moneydance 2023.2, the latest update to our comprehensive personal finance software.
